Content Delivery Networks (CDN’s) verbeteren de prestaties door de latentie te verminderen en de snelheid van de levering van inhoud te verbeteren voor gebruikers die toegang hebben tot webinhoud vanaf verschillende locaties wereldwijd. CDN’s bereiken dit door inhoud, zoals afbeeldingen, video’s, scripts en andere webmiddelen, in het cachegeheugen op te slaan op servers die strategisch verspreid zijn over meerdere geografische locaties. Wanneer een gebruiker inhoud opvraagt, stuurt het CDN het verzoek automatisch naar de dichtstbijzijnde server, in plaats van naar de oorspronkelijke server, waardoor de gegevensafstand wordt verminderd en het aantal netwerkhops wordt geminimaliseerd. Deze nabijheid vermindert de latentie en versnelt de levering van inhoud, wat resulteert in snellere laadtijden en verbeterde algehele prestaties voor websites en webapplicaties.
Om CDN effectief te gebruiken voor prestatieverbetering, integreren organisaties doorgaans CDN-services in hun webinfrastructuur door DNS-instellingen te configureren of de API’s van CDN-providers te gebruiken om de levering van inhoud te beheren. Begin met het identificeren van kritieke webmiddelen die baat hebben bij caching, zoals statische bestanden en media-inhoud die vaak door gebruikers wordt gebruikt. Upload deze assets naar het CDN-platform of configureer de oorspronkelijke serverinstellingen om inhoud automatisch te synchroniseren met CDN edge-servers. Implementeer CDN-cachingregels en -optimalisaties, zoals het instellen van cachevervaltijden, het inschakelen van compressietechnieken en het configureren van cachingbeleid op basis van inhoudstypen en gebruikerstoegangspatronen. Bewaak CDN-prestatiestatistieken en analyses om de effectiviteit te evalueren, knelpunten te identificeren en strategieën voor contentlevering te optimaliseren voor continue prestatieverbetering.
Een CDN lost prestatieproblemen op die verband houden met latentie, bandbreedtebeperkingen en serveroverbelasting door inhoud dichter bij de eindgebruikers te distribueren. Door inhoud te cachen en af te leveren vanaf edge-servers die zich in de buurt van gebruikerspopulaties bevinden, minimaliseren CDN’s de impact van geografische afstand en netwerkcongestie op de datatransmissiesnelheden. Deze aanpak vermindert de belasting op de oorspronkelijke servers, verbetert de schaalbaarheid om fluctuerende verkeersvolumes aan te kunnen en zorgt voor een consistente beschikbaarheid van webinhoud tijdens piekperioden. CDN-providers maken gebruik van geavanceerde caching-algoritmen, verkeersbeheertechnieken en wereldwijde netwerkinfrastructuren om de routes voor het leveren van inhoud te optimaliseren, latentieproblemen te verminderen en naadloze gebruikerservaringen te bieden in verschillende geografische regio’s en netwerkomstandigheden.
Cloud CDN-services dragen aanzienlijk bij aan het verbeteren van de prestaties van webapplicaties door gebruik te maken van cloud computing-bronnen en schaalbare infrastructuur. Cloud CDN’s kunnen worden geïntegreerd met cloudplatforms, zoals Amazon Web Services (AWS), Google Cloud Platform (GCP) en Microsoft Azure, om het wereldwijde bereik te vergroten, de schaalbaarheid te verbeteren en de leveringsactiviteiten van content te stroomlijnen. Door CDN-edge-nodes in cloudregio’s over de hele wereld te implementeren, bieden cloud-CDN-providers contentlevering met lage latentie, hoge beschikbaarheid en robuuste beveiligingsfuncties. Cloud CDN’s schalen bronnen dynamisch om verkeerspieken op te vangen, werklasten efficiënt te verdelen en datatransmissiepaden te optimaliseren op basis van realtime netwerkomstandigheden. Deze aanpak garandeert betrouwbare applicatieprestaties, versnelt de levering van inhoud en ondersteunt naadloze schaalbaarheid voor in de cloud gehoste webservices en -applicaties.
Het implementeren van CDN biedt verschillende voordelen die de webprestaties, gebruikerservaring en operationele efficiëntie voor organisaties verbeteren. Ten eerste verbetert CDN de laadtijden en het reactievermogen van websites door de responstijden van de server te verkorten en de gegevenslatentie voor eindgebruikers te minimaliseren. Verbeterde leveringssnelheid van inhoud leidt tot hogere klanttevredenheid, grotere gebruikersbetrokkenheid en verbeterde retentiepercentages. CDN beperkt het risico op downtime en verbetert de betrouwbaarheid van de website door het verkeer over meerdere servers te verdelen, waardoor de beschikbaarheid en fouttolerantie worden verbeterd. Bovendien helpt CDN het bandbreedtegebruik te optimaliseren, de serverbelasting te verminderen en de infrastructuurkosten te verlagen door taken voor het leveren van inhoud naar edge-servers te verplaatsen. Door gebruik te maken van CDN-cachingmogelijkheden en netwerkoptimalisaties bereiken organisaties betere prestatieresultaten, optimaliseren ze het gebruik van bronnen en leveren ze superieure digitale ervaringen aan een wereldwijd publiek.